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0561531171 7467254883 84046 667793052
864 30280 2272706
864 30280 2272706
89648 08483454493 42155 443226734
All about undefined
Interested in learning more?
864 30280 2272706
89648 08483454493 42155 443226734
See more
49585849 267673
4876938814 325 89882
See more
39 570 5074482116
53 98820 710200
See more